Job Summary:
Education:
Requires knowledge of anatomy, physiology, microbiology, pulmonary physics, pulmonary physiology, advanced respiratory care, mathematics, blood chemistry, and pharmacology at a level generally acquired through completion of a two-year AMA approved program in respiratory therapy. Must be registered (RRT) and have a current Alabama respiratory license.
Experience:
Approximately six to twelve months of progressively more responsible related work experience necessary to gain a complete understanding of respiratory therapy principles and procedures to provide assistance in the resolution of difficult work-related problems. Completes initial and annual competencies and assists with other staff members.
Additional Skills/Abilities:
Recommend being certified in ACLS, PALS, and CPR.
